I met up with Steve and Erin today at the track for a little racing fun. It was hot and humid as hell, but we still had a great time.

Steve was fighting the usual gremlins, trying to figure out his launch control and tire pressure. When his car wasn't going into limp mode it was stalling. He still managed a 11.92 @ 122 against a 20 second car. As Steve says, he's got a 10 second car with a 11 second driver. I'm looking forward to his car running the way it should, as it will be more fun for us both. It's not very fun watching your buddy struggle, knowing he's frustrated. I've been there, and it's not a fun place to be.

My wife only recorded Erin's slow run (12.8), but I believe he pulled off a 12.5 before we left. The DA was pretty high today.

As for me, it was two 11.5's. I think I was running slower due to narrowing the plug gap for a 100 shot, but I only ran a 75. I'm going to open the plug gap tomorrow, and forget the 100 or 125 shot until fall.

dropping the hammer at 4500 rpm doc! beech bend is a major badass track. they had so much prep down the first run i had dropped tire pressure to 30 psi and the r888 tire hooked SO HARD i actually stalled the car! the forward motion with the key on restarted the car and it lurched forward again. a whopping 2.9 60 ft time!
last run with grip i had a better launch airing the tires up to 33 psi but car went into limp mode down the track. i think i hit a torque limiter.

its a work in progress but man its tough!

stage 2.5 sachs clutch les. good for 700 hp. the 997 have a completely different setup with variable turbos and launch easier. the pdk 997 turbos are in another class again and can run 10.7 with street tires bone stock! slipping the clutch off the line makes for a slow 60 ft. need the boost up and launch it hard to get the needed 1.8 and better 60 ft times
